Shares of Spotify rose 13% on Thursday following the company’s first investor day since 2022, where management laid out financial targets for 2030 and announced an artificial intelligence agreement with Universal Music Group (UMG). The move signals how the streaming industry is navigating the disruptive potential of AI. Spotify said it expects revenue to grow at a compound annual growth rate in the mid-teens, with gross margins ranging from 35% to 40%. The company described its long-term ambition to reach 1 billion subscribers and $100 billion in annual revenue as its “north star.” Co-CEO Gustav Söderström told CNBC’s Julia Boorstin: “We are still firing on all cylinders. We’re seeing strong growth in free users and in subscribers.” Under the AI deal with UMG, Spotify plans to launch a feature that would let premium users create covers and remixes using the voices of artists and songwriters who opt in. The tool is expected to be offered as a paid add-on, providing a potential new revenue stream for artists. Spotify had previously indicated it was collaborating with major music labels to develop “responsible” AI tools. Key takeaways from Spotify’s investor event center on its confidence in user growth and monetization amid industry shifts. The guidance implies that Spotify may continue to expand its free-tier user base while converting more listeners into paying subscribers. The company’s emphasis on gross margin improvement—targeting 35% to 40%—could reflect increasing efficiency in content acquisition costs and advertising revenue. The AI partnership with UMG could reshape how artists and fans interact, potentially creating incremental revenue through AI-generated derivatives. However, the opt-in model suggests that legal and ethical boundaries around artist rights remain a focal point. The market’s positive reaction—a 13% surge—indicates that investors may view both the long-term financial trajectory and the AI initiative as catalysts for sustained growth. From an investment perspective, Spotify’s updated targets and AI deal may signal a strategic pivot toward higher-margin, user-generated content layers. The mid-teens revenue CAGR and $100 billion “north star” imply that management sees significant untapped market potential—possibly through podcasting, audiobooks, and now AI-enabled personalization. Yet, risks could include regulatory scrutiny over AI-generated music, artist pushback, and the uncertainty of hitting subscriber milestones in a competitive streaming landscape. The cautious language used by executives—such as “north star” rather than a formal forecast—suggests that these goals are aspirational. Broader industry dynamics, including pricing power and label negotiations, could influence Spotify’s ability to achieve its margin targets.
